Stevie Wonder's music career began at the tender age of 11 when he was discovered by Ronnie White, a member of the Motown group The Miracles. Signed to Motown Records in 1962, Stevie Wonder released his debut album, , which showcased his talent as a harmonica player and singer. Over the next few years, he released several albums, including Tribute to Uncle Ray (1964) and Little Stevie Wonder (1965), which featured his early interpretations of soul and R&B classics. After a ten-year hiatus from studio albums, Wonder returned with A Time to Love in 2005. The album featured collaborations with modern stars like India.Arie and Prince. It proved his vocal prowess and songwriting capabilities remained completely intact. Between 2005 and 2009, Wonder focused heavily on massive world tours, live DVD releases, and preserving his extensive catalog for future generations. 5.
